  1. Interreg IIIC2000-2006 Cohesion Forum Brussels, 21-22 May 2001 http://inforegio.cec.eu.int/interreg3

  2. INTERREG: €4875 mio • IIIA: cross-border co-operation (67%) • IIIB: transnational co-operation (27%) • IIIC: interregional co-operation (6%)“allowing non-contiguous regions to build up relationships, leading to exchange of experience and networking”

  3. Programme-based approach NEW  strategic approach  coherence within Interreg III  improve monitoring and evaluation processes  simplify administrative procedures

  4. Programme Management • Programme areas • Allocation of money • Management/Paying authority • Common secretariat

  5. Programme areas:South ZoneNorth-West ZoneEast ZoneNorth-East Zone

  6. Participation • All EU territory eligible • Involvement of : • Candidate / third countries • Insular/outermost regions • Aid rates (cf. General Regulation)

Regional Framework Operations OPERATIONS Types of applications TOPICS Best practise from Ind. projects Regional Framework Operations Networks • 50-80% of programme budget (indic.) • Regional or equivalent regional bodies • Min. 3 countries, min. 2 Member States • Strategic approach • Partnership • By group of regions • on limited range of subjects • ERDF: 500.000-5 mill Euro Objective 1-2 INTERREG Urban dev. Individual projects OPERATIONS Types of applications TOPICS Best practise from Individual projects Networks RFO Objective 1-2 • 10-30% of programme budget • (indic.) • Public authorities or equivalent • bodies • Min. 3 countries, 2 Member States • Project-based approach • Exchange of experience • ERDF: 200.000-1 mill Euro INTERREG Urban dev. Networks OPERATIONS Types of applications TOPICS Best practise from Networks Individual projects RFO • 10-20% of programme budget (indic.) • Public authorities or equivalent bodies • Min. 5 countries, min. 3 Member States • Exchange of experience • costs related to seminars, conferences, • web- sites, databases, study tours, • exchange of staff • ERDF: 200.000-1 mill Euro Objective 1-2 INTERREG Urban dev.
